Le Labo fragrances was born in Grasse (France), raised in New York (USA) and offers artisanal genderless scented creations (fine perfumery, home fragrance as well as formulas for body, hair, and face). Le Labo stands for "the lab" in French: Each of our boutique's function like an open laboratory designed as an entertainment park for the senses where people can take the time to smell and touch raw ingredients to awaken their olfactory system and trigger emotions. We freshly hand-blend our fragrances on site, to the order and each label is personalized with the date and place of the formulation as well as a message chosen by our client. Creating soulful Beauty with Care through our craft of slow perfumery is the heartbeat of our company. We work with a community of craftspeople who shape our world: the flower harvesters, the local family farms, the candle hand-pourers, the reclaimed wood artisans, the lab technicians etc.

**Job Summary**
Our labs (stores) are a central part of unique experience - and those labs a result from the marriage of American vintage industrial design and wabi sabi, the Japanese philosophy that refers to the beauty of nature and things as they are, the beauty of the imperfect, impermanent and incomplete. We strive to make each lab unique - the opposite of cookie-cutter - drawing on their uniqueness and original character; yet all our labs have a consistent 'feeling' no matter where you find us, as they are a reflection of our values and a 3D translation of our soul.
